Volunteers make the works go 'round

9/4/2019

0 Comments

 
Volunteering is the ultimate exercise in democracy. You vote in elections once a year, but when you volunteer, you vote every day about the kind of community you want to live in.
— 
Marjorie Moore

The first time I saw this quote, my instant reaction was, "oh yeah!" Look around ... Why is Gothenburg used as an example for many across the state, even the country? (i.e. All-America City) Because there are a whole host of residents willing to volunteer, willing to sacrifice their personal time to ensure the quality of life in Gothenburg sets the trend for others. 

In the Chamber of Commerce world, we work with volunteers every day. Folks who serve on the board of directors give their time. Committee members give their time. People freely volunteer to help set up events, work during events and we never have to wonder if there will be enough people to clean up. Obviously, the Chamber is not unique in this.

Look at our theatre, our senior center, even our school system. We wouldn't have nearly the programs, events, rock-solid civic institutions that we enjoy in Gothenburg without the people here who are willing to give and give and give. Basically, we've built a culture,  an expectation of volunteerism.

Of course there are those who seem to get called upon over and over. They are recognized for their generosity of time and they've proven they can get things done. There are others who are a bit more conservative taking on commitments, but still highly trustworthy. 

Each of us has a responsibility to preserve the spirit of volunteering. The Gothenburg school system has made a conscious effort to teach our kids the value of doing something for others with no expectation of getting anything in return. But let's not leave this mission entirely to our educators. Ask your neighbor to come along when you're volunteering at church. Talk to the new guy at work about joining your favorite civic group. Get involved and help the rookies in town jump in feet first as well.

You can't always control your taxes, the people who move into your neighborhood or where you get to park at the grocery store, but you can control where you spend your spare time. You might as well make your community a better place.
